If the slide guides are not adjusted correctly
for the paper size, the quality of your copy
images may be adversely affected.
When you insert an envelope and thick
paper, push the paper toward the inside of
the machine lightly to feed paper firmly.
If the paper is curled, uncurl it before
placing it in the cassette or multi-purpose
tray. Failure to do so will cause paper
creases and a paper jam.
Some types of paper may not feed properly
into the cassette or multi-purpose tray. For
high-quality copies, be sure to use the
paper and transparencies recommended by
Canon. ( p. 2-1)
When making copies of a small size
document or thick paper, etc., the copy
speed may be slightly slower than usual.
